Adnams Lightens Up To Go Green

Adnams has released a new environmentally friendly bottle across its ale range, as part of a company-wide green initiative. "We were looking at re-branding the range anyway, so decided to make it greener as well," said Marketing Manager Ed Hume. WRAP recently challenged drinks suppliers and retailers to reduce the amount of glass used to package products. The new Adnams bottle weighs in at less than 300g, more than 155g lighter than the previous bottle. "It also delivers cost benefits as a lorry-load is now lighter," said Hume. "In addition, we moved our manufacturing to Harlow from Scotland, so we are also improving our carbon footprint." The company is hoping that the move will be welcomed by consumers as well as retailers and it will be communicating the benefits of the bottles as part of its brand story. The new bottle will arrive in stores at the end of January.
